Brake Fluid
The fluid level should be between the  MIN 
and  MAX  marks on the side of the reserve 
tank.

Replacing Light Bulbs
Headlights
Headlights are LED type. Have an authorized Honda dealer inspect and replace the 
light assembly.

Taillights
Taillights are LED type. Have an authorized Honda dealer inspect and replace the 
light assembly.

Rear License Plate Light
Rear license plate light is LED type. Have an authorized Honda dealer inspect and 
replace the light assembly
